Top quality French pastries however was disappointed at them serving coffee in take away cups even for dine in customers. This really detracts from the flavour. Would have been nice if they served pastry on a plate rather than in a takeaway bag too.

Lovely cake and croissant selection (although béchamel instead of cheese in a ham and cheese croissant was a bit weird). Disappointing that you can only get takeaway cups and containers while eating in.
